Philip Schnackenberg shares a personal reflection on faith, belief, and the challenges of living out Christian convictions. He discusses the journey from inherited faith to personal ownership of belief, the discomfort of difficult biblical teachings, and the importance of grounding one’s worldview in truth. The sermon explores four key questions about origin, morality, meaning, and destiny, arguing that Christianity provides coherent answers where secular worldviews fall short.
